Output 77699706fa0ca3c62fc854359d65e2cfb905f53e4293fee84638bb7fe89e1030:2

value
133933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b4a5e496a8cabf1dc326c77bb3cd2fde39160d OP_EQUAL
address
39EKjvDK6UEkpaBcLVbBen1M4dhh2iE9Lq
transaction
77699706fa0ca3c62fc854359d65e2cfb905f53e4293fee84638bb7fe89e1030
confirmations
286878
spent
true